Scroll up
Skip to main content
Article/Newspaper
Details
Newspaper:
: The Observer
Details
Newspaper:
: The Observer
Details
Newspaper:
: The Observer
Details
Newspaper:
: The Observer
Details
Newspaper:
: The Observer
Details
Newspaper:
: The Observer
Details
Newspaper:
: The Observer
Details
Newspaper:
: The Observer
Details
Newspaper:
: The Observer
Details
Newspaper:
: The New York Times
Subscribe to Article/Newspaper